Ted Cruz Believes 'Donald's Calculator Is Missing a Few Keys'

The Republicans are battling before New York's primary Tuesday.

In addition to slamming Trump's delegate calculations on the campaign trail, Cruz also expressed his lack of interest in being Trump's vice president.

"There are a lot of reasons, but perhaps the simplest is that if Donald is the nominee, Hillary wins, by double digits," Cruz said.

"If Donald's the nominee, he loses. If I'm the nominee, we win.”

Even though Cruz won the delegates that were up for grabs in Wyoming this weekend, he still trails Trump in the delegate count.

"Donald's calculator is missing a few keys," Cruz said in discussing Trump's prospects of getting to the required 1,237 delegates in order to secure the nomination.
